Channel sensing for full-duplex sidelink communications
Abstract:
Methods, systems, and devices for wireless communications are described. In some cases, a sidelink user equipment (UE) may receive a configuration for performing a channel sensing procedure of a sidelink resource selection procedure for identifying sidelink resource candidates in a resource selection window. The configuration may indicate a first channel metric and a second channel metric for performing the channel sensing procedure. The UE may measure reference signaling in a sensing window according to one or both of the first and second channel metrics based on a duplex mode of the UE while performing the channel sensing. The reference signaling may correspond to a set of sidelink resource candidates in a resource selection window. The UE may determine an available set of sidelink resource candidates for a sidelink transmission from the set of sidelink resource candidates based on the measuring.
